How much does it cost to rent an apartment in El Segundo?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
El Segundo Studio Apartments | $1,865 | $1,106 | $3,100 |
| El Segundo 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,513 | $1,450 | $3,700 |
| El Segundo 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,252 | $2,145 | $6,400 |
| El Segundo 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,904 | $2,746 | $4,950 |
| El Segundo 4 Bedroom Apartments | $10,433 | $7,999 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io El Segundo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in El Segundo with Studio?
Currently the most affordable Studio in El Segundo is at Concourse listed at $1,088.
How much is the average rent for a Studio El Segundo Apartment?
The average rent for a Studio Apartment in El Segundo is $1,865.
What is the largest available Studio El Segundo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in El Segundo is a 743 square feet unit starting from $2,744 at Pacific Place.
What is the average size for El Segundo Studio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Studio rental in El Segundo is currently 365 sq ft.
